What is behind the fish shortage in The Gambia?

Focus on Africa

Available for over a year

People in The Gambia have been complaining of a shortage of fish, which is the primary source of protein for many in the country. The finger of blame has been pointed at Chinese trawlers accussed of over-fishing in Gambian waters, with allegations of bribery of officials to look the other way. Journalist, Mustapha K Darboe of the Malagen news website helped break the story and has been talking to the Âé¶¹Éç's Esau Williams. (Photo: A woman walks past a fish merchant at the Banjul market.
